Catalan

[edit]

Etymology

[edit]

Borrowed from Latin labōrāre. Cognate to the doublet llaurar.

Pronunciation

[edit]

Verb

[edit]

laborar (first-person singular present laboro, first-person singular preterite laborí, past participle laborat); root stress: (Central, Valencia, Balearic) /o/

  1. to work (make an effort to accomplish something)

Spanish

[edit]

Etymology

[edit]

Borrowed from Latin labōrāre. Doublet of labrar.

Pronunciation

[edit]
  • IPA(key): /laboˈɾaɾ/ [la.β̞oˈɾaɾ]
  • Rhymes: -aɾ
  • Syllabification: la‧bo‧rar

Verb

[edit]

laborar (first-person singular present laboro, first-person singular preterite laboré, past participle laborado)

  1. to labor, work
    Synonym: trabajar
